It’s a deeply personal movie but at the same time very universal to the ones who are able to relate to the stories. Many subjects are brought to light in this movie. There is this idea that some immigrants have betrayed their home country by leaving and living the other side’s lifestyle. "La Malinche" is mentioned as an insult because she was the woman who contributed to the Spanish conquest of the Aztec Empire, by acting as an interpreter. Some parts are about the modern disaster that journalism has become with pseudo journalists being mind parasites. So many issues are tackled in this movie where the absurd is not so absurd anymore. The inequalities and the injustices are so part of our daily lives that we became used to them. We blinded ourselves so much that sometimes we even make the unthinkable a reality, with no resistance. That's scary.
